I applied through a HR and then I had two 45 minutes phone interviews back to back. Both of the phone interviews were extremely technical and required you to code on google docs. In the beginning of both interviews, I was asked simple technical questions like what is hashtable and linked list and basic data structure questions. I screwed up coding part for both my interviews.

After submitting my application for the Software Engineer position, I received an invitation to complete an automated Online Assessment (OA). The assessment consisted of standard coding challenges, primarily focusing on algorithmic and data structure problems. Unfortunately, a few days after submitting my solutions for the assessment, I received an email informing me that I would not be moving forward in the interview process and was rejected.
